How To Say “Incredible” in Spanish

Introduction

When we come across something amazing, astonishing, or unbelievable, we often use the word “incredible” to express our awe and admiration. In this article, we will explore different ways to say “incredible” in Spanish, providing you with a range of options to convey your sense of wonder and amazement.

The Translation: “Increíble”

The word for “incredible” in Spanish is “increíble.” This term directly translates to the English word and is widely used to describe something extraordinary, astonishing, or unbelievable.

Usage and Context

To help you understand how to use “increíble” in a Spanish context, let’s explore a few examples:1. “El paisaje es increíblemente hermoso.” Translation: “The landscape is incredibly beautiful.” This sentence demonstrates the usage of “increíble” to describe the breathtaking beauty of a landscape.2. “¡Es increíble lo que has logrado!” Translation: “It’s incredible what you have achieved!” Here, “increíble” is used to express admiration and astonishment towards someone’s accomplishments.3. “Vivimos una experiencia increíble durante nuestro viaje.” Translation: “We had an incredible experience during our trip.” In this example, “increíble” is used to convey the extraordinary nature of the experience lived during the trip.

Alternative Phrases

While “increíble” is the most common and straightforward way to express “incredible” in Spanish, there are alternative phrases you can use to convey a similar meaning:1. “Asombroso” Translation: “Amazing” or “Astounding” This word emphasizes the sense of wonder and awe similar to “incredible.”2. “Impresionante” Translation: “Impressive” or “Mind-blowing” “Impresionante” conveys the idea of something that leaves a strong impact and is difficult to believe or comprehend.3. “Sorprendente” Translation: “Surprising” or “Stunning” This term suggests something that causes surprise or amazement, similar to the feeling conveyed by “incredible.”

Conclusion

Having the ability to express the concept of “incredible” in Spanish allows you to effectively communicate your sense of awe and amazement. Whether you use “increíble,” “asombroso,” “impresionante,” or “sorprendente,” you can accurately convey the extraordinary nature of something. Remember to choose the appropriate phrase based on the context and intensity of the experience. ¡Increíble! (Incredible!)
